SOS working group
About
The SOS working group maintains and administrates
Indymedias installation of a ticket based issue/incident/response tracking software. While formerly a software called
Request Tracker was used for this, we have now moved on to
OTRS, which is easier to configure, manage, administrate and extend (and there are Debian packages, too).
The working group was formed during the
NewTechOrientation2005 meeting, back then it was called Request Tracker Working Group. For more information on Request Tracker, please have a look at the - currently outdated and unmaintained

Who/what is able to have a queue on SOS and how?
- Currently, there are 4 queues that have been setup:
- Docs: docs.indymedia.org tech working group related queue, where new wiki accounts creation advisory are sent
- Listwork: Listwork working group queue, mostly used by the http://newlist.indymedia.org form
- DNS: DNS working group queue, where dns requests should end up.
- SoS: SoS working group queue, for new queue/admin account or bug reports/features requests
